Before you get started, ensure that all the drivers required for your USB device(s) are installed.

LEX = Local Extender, REX = Remote Extender

1 1 Place extenders where desired and connect the fiber cable to the Link ports (LC) on the

LEX and REX.

Connect the LEX to the computer’s USB 3 port using the included USB cable.

Includes the ExtremeUSB-C™ suite of features:

▪ Transparent USB extension supporting USB 3, 2 and 1

True plug and play; no software drivers required

▪ Works with all major operating systems: Windows®, macOS™, Linux® and Chrome OS™

Product Operation and Storage

Please read and follow all instructions provided with this product, and operate for intended use only. Do not attempt to open the product casing as this may cause damage and will void warranty. Use only the power supply provided with this product. When not in use, product should be stored in a dry location between -20°C and 70°C. Limited Hardware Warranty

Icron Technologies Corporation warrants that any hardware products accompanying this documentation shall be free from significant defects in material and workmanship for a period of two years from the date of purchase. Icron Technologies Corporation’s hardware warranty extends to Licensee, its customers and end users. The warranty does not include repair of failures caused by: misuse, neglect, accident, modification, operation outside a normal operating environment, service of the device by non-authorized servicers or a product for which Icron is not responsible.

Hardware Remedies

Icron Technologies Corporation’s entire liability and the Licensee’s exclusive remedy for any breach of warranty, shall be, at Icron Technologies

Corporation’s option, either: (a) return of the price paid, or (b) repair or replacement of hardware, which will be warranted for the remainder of the original warranty period or 30 days, whichever is longer. These remedies are void if failure of the hardware has resulted from accident, abuse or misapplication.

Obtaining Warranty Service

To obtain warranty service, you must contact Icron Technologies Corporation within the warranty period for a Return Material Authorization (RMA) number. Icron Technologies

Corporation will not accept returns without an authorized RMA number. Be sure to include the serial numbers of the LEX unit and REX unit in any of your email correspondence. Package the product appropriately for safe shipment and mark the RMA number on the outside of the package. The package must be sent prepaid to Icron Technologies Corporation. We recommend that you insure or send it by a method that provides package tracking. The repaired or replaced item will be shipped to you, at Icron Technologies Corporation’s expense, not later than thirty days after Icron Technologies Corporation receives the defective product.
